Weather in Meghalaya during August

Average temperatures across Meghalaya in August sit around 23-31°C. The general character: monsoon continues — slightly less intense.

Shillong sits at 1,525 m altitude; expect cool evenings year-round. Different altitudes within the state will feel noticeably different — coastal/lowland areas can be 10°C warmer than high-altitude passes on the same day.

What to do in Meghalaya in August

Highlight: lower-altitude Sikkim and Meghalaya start clearing; sometimes 2-3 dry days back-to-back possible.

Watch out for: still landslide risk; road closures common; bookings can be cancelled last-minute.

Cost outlook for Meghalaya in August

Off-peak pricing — accommodation is 30-50% cheaper, but many attractions may be closed. See our complete budget guide for tier-by-tier daily costs.
